Abstract :
Thiokol Corp. has developed an integrated probabilistic design approach. The approach produces systems with higher reliability and availability, and lower program life cycle costs, by ensuring that reliability assessments are an integral part of the design and manufacturing process. The reliability of a system is verified for a significantly lower cost than traditional binomial (success/failure) reliability demonstration programs. Process characterization is effectively planned as part of the design process and included as an integral part of the design demonstration, testing, and evaluation program. Thiokol´s statistical approach for engineering reliability, an approach developed and adopted as the design methodology that will be used to meet the product assurance needs for future solid rocket motors, is presented. Because of the robust nature of this approach, it can be applied within any manufacturing industry to increase reliability while decreasing overall program costs
